___187_. The Manhattan Silver Mining Company, located in New York, formed a branch in Austin, Nevada in 1863. The company was the largest silver producer in the district by 1867. This company was the first to use the Stedfeldt Furnace, which reduced costs by half, and continued production until 1888.
